Distance from Chicago to Fort Lauderdale by Car and Plane

The flight distance from Chicago (IL) to Fort Lauderdale (FL) is 1168 miles or 1879 kilometers or 1014 nautical miles.
Driving distance from Chicago to Fort Lauderdale is 1351 miles (2175 kilometers).
Difference between fly and travel by a car is 183 miles or 296 km.

What is the average flight time from Chicago to Fort Lauderdale?

Flight time from Chicago, IL to Fort Lauderdale, FL is 2 hours 41 minutes under average conditions.
Exact flight times may vary depending on aircraft type, weather conditions, baggage load, and other environmental factors.

Time Difference between Chicago and Fort Lauderdale

Time difference between Chicago (IL) and Fort Lauderdale (FL) is 1 Hours.
Fort Lauderdale time is 1 Hours ahead of Chicago.
